NHTSA ID Number: 10244799
Manufacturer Communication Number: TSB 23-2336
Summary
Some 2023 F-Super Duty vehicles equipped with a 12.3 inch IPC display screen and no HUD may exhibit the IPC bezel misaligned to IPC display screen in lower left corner. This may be due to the locating holes in the instrument panel substrate for the IPC bezel. To correct the condition, follow the Service Procedure to drill out the lower left side locator hole.
Model:
| Ford 2023 F-Super Duty | Built on or before 15-Aug-2023 |
Issue: Some 2023 F-Super Duty vehicles built on or before 15-Aug-2023, equipped with a 12.3 inch IPC display screen and no HUD may exhibit the IPC bezel misaligned to the IPC display screen in lower left corner. This may be due to the locating holes in the instrument panel substrate for the IPC bezel. To correct the condition, follow the Service Procedure to drill out the lower left side locator hole.
Action: Follow the Service Procedure to correct the condition on vehicles that meet all of the following criteria:
- 2023 F-Super Duty built on or before 15-Aug-2023
- Equipped with a 12.3 inch IPC display screen
- Without head up display (HUD)
- IPC bezel misaligned to the IPC display screen in lower left
Service Procedure
1. Remove the IPC bezel. Refer to Workshop Manual (WSM), Section 413-01 > Removal and Installation > Instrument Panel Cluster (IPC) Display Screen – Vehicles With: 12.3 Inch Instrument Cluster Display Screen, Steps 1 through 11.
2. Drill out the lower left locator hole using a 7/16 in. (11mm) drill bit. (Figure 1)
Figure 1
3. Install the IPC bezel. Refer to WSM, Section 413-01 > Removal and Installation > Instrument Panel Cluster (IPC) Display Screen – Vehicles With: 12.3 Inch Instrument Cluster Display Screen, reversing Steps 1 through 11.

Warranty Status: Eligible under provisions of New Vehicle Limited Warranty (NVLW)/Service Part Warranty (SPW)/Special Service Part (SSP)/Extended Service Plan (ESP) coverage. Limits/policies/prior approvals are not altered by a TSB. NVLW/SPW/SSP/ESP coverage limits are determined by the identified causal part and verified using the OASIS part coverage tool.
Labor Times Description 2023 F-Super Duty: Create A Locator Hole Following The Service Procedure (Do Not Use With Any Other Labor Operations) Operation No.
232336A Time 0.6
Hrs.
Repair/Claim Coding Causal Part: 26044D70 Condition Code: 07 Service Procedure
